What are the inverters that do not require energy storage
These inverters convert the direct current (DC) generated by solar panels into alternating current (AC), which is used by most household and commercial appliances. One of the key features of on-grid systems is that they do not require energy storage (batteries). [pdf][FAQS about What are the inverters that do not require energy storage ]

The role of reactors in photovoltaic inverters
Output reactors are essentially inductive devices that are connected at the output side of power inverters. Their primary function is to filter and improve the quality of the output current waveform. [pdf][FAQS about The role of reactors in photovoltaic inverters]
